Contact charging technology OEM is based on conductive charging systems, where the electric toothbrush charges via direct contact with a metallic base or magnetic charger—without the need for visible charging ports. This not only improves water resistance but also enhances the product’s aesthetic appeal.
Key features of contact technology in electric toothbrushes:
Waterproof & sealed design (typically IPX7+ rated)
Magnetic alignment for safe, efficient docking
Reduced mechanical wear, increasing product lifespan
Compatible with wireless bathroom accessories or multi-device stations

Partnering with a reliable electric toothbrushes manufacturer that specializes in wireless charging electric toothbrush OEM production brings several advantages:
Customization options: Tailor brush heads, charging docks, motor frequency, and packaging to fit your brand.
Cost efficiency at scale: Lower per-unit pricing through volume wholesale production.
Faster go-to-market: Many factories have pre-certified components, reducing R&D and compliance time.
Private labeling: Branding flexibility for packaging and device engraving.

When selecting a factory for your contact technology electric toothbrush line, it’s important to evaluate several key factors:
Experience with contact charging systems
In-house tooling and R&D capability
Certifications (e.g., CE, FCC, FDA, ISO9001)
Production capacity and lead time
Support for product testing and quality assurance
